Diurnal Gene Variation in Mouse Eye


ABSTRACT: The purpose of this study was to explore diurnal gene expression changes that occur in the RPE/Choroid/Sclera. Mice C57BL/6J were purchased from the Jackson Laboratory (Bar Harbor, ME) and raised to approximately 2 months of age and entrained to a 12hr/12hr light/dark cycle for two weeks. Eye cups from male mice were rapidly dissected and RPE/ choroid/sclera tissues were collected over three consecutive diurnal cycles at Zeitgeber time (ZT) 0.5, 1, 1.5, 4, 11, 13, 16, and 23 hrs, for a total of 24 time points. Three mice were used for each time point and dissections for dark time points were done under dim-red light. To generate a reference RNA for microarray hybridization, whole eyes from equal numbers of male and female mice were collected at ZT6 and ZT7. Time: Samples were collected at the indicated Zeitgeber time points
